+
+var reGoVersion = regexp.MustCompile(` \(go\d+([\d.])*\)$`)
+
+// Return true if either a==b or the only difference is that one has a
+// " (go1.2.3)" suffix and the other does not.
+//
+// This allows us to recognize a non-Go (rails) service as the same
+// version as a Go service.
+func sameVersion(a, b string) bool {
+       if a == b {
+               return true
+       }
+       anogo := reGoVersion.ReplaceAllLiteralString(a, "")
+       bnogo := reGoVersion.ReplaceAllLiteralString(b, "")
+       if (anogo == a) != (bnogo == b) {
+               // only one of a/b has a (go1.2.3) suffix, so compare
+               // without that part
+               return anogo == bnogo
+       }
+       // both or neither has a (go1.2.3) suffix, and we already know
+       // a!=b
+       return false
+}
